Abstract

We show for $n,k\geq1$, and an $n$-dimensional complex vector space $V$ that if an element $A\in\text{End}(V)[[z]]$ has constant term similar to a Jordan block, then there exists a polynomial gauge transformation $g$ such that the first $k$ coefficients of $gAg^{-1}$ have a controlled normal form. Furthermore, we show that this normal form is unique by demonstrating explicit relationships between the first $nk$ coefficients of the Puiseux series expansion of the eigenvalues of $A$ and the entries of the first $k$ coefficients of $gAg^{-1}$.<br />Comment: 13 pages, to appear in Involve: A Journal of Mathematics
